Edexcel A-Level Mathematics – Overview
- A two-year linear qualification (all exams at the end of Year 13).
- Designed for students who achieved well in GCSE Mathematics (typically Grade 6+).
- Provides a deep grounding in pure mathematics, with applications in statistics and mechanics.
- Widely required for STEM degrees (engineering, physics, computer science, economics)
Assessment
- Three exams at the end of Year 13 (all 2 hours, equally weighted).
- Pure Mathematics 1 (100 marks)
- Pure Mathematics 2 (100 marks)
- Statistics & Mechanics (50 marks each)
- No coursework.
- Calculators are allowed in all papers (e.g., Casio ClassWiz recommended).
